- The distance between Riga, Latvia and Aracaju, Brazil is approximately 9,363 km or 5,819 mi.
- To reach Riga in this distance one would set out from Aracaju bearing 28.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Riga bearing 59.7° or ENE .
- Riga has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Aracaju has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Riga is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Aracaju is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 19.8 °C (35.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.9 °C (34°F) more in Riga.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 958.8 mm (37.7 in) less which is equivalent to 958.8 l/m² (23.53 US gal/ft²) or 9,588,000 l/ha (1,025,021 US gal/ac) less. About 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 39.5° lower in Riga than in Aracaju.
- Relative humidity levels are 1.6%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 18.9°C (33.9°F) lower.
